Hello,
If you cut a trace and run a couple of wires the tail light can even be made to flash the revo flight mode, arming status, etc. It's actually a ws2811 led strip.
Can you tell me more about this trace please ?
Thank you
-
The connections are labeled on the led circuit board, vcc, gnd, dat. That dat one is the one you connect to in the wiki LED instructions at https://librepilot.atlassian.net/wiki/display/LPDOC/Setup+WS281x+Led
As shipped from the factory the led dat is connected to the pdb stm8 processor so the lights can be controlled using a spare accessory channel. If you cut the trace to dat and jumper it to one of the outputs shown in the wiki above it'll blink the status instead of being a solid color.
Remember, this only works if you've upgraded the racer 250 to a revo. The firmware for the stock CC3d board doesn't support leds.

Sorry but i certainly misunderstood.
I have unsoldered DAT from the main board to the tail led strip. Connected it to the flexi-io pin 3, activated led_strip in settings. But i have nearly the same behavior : When i put power on the racer, led strip just takes a new color, and keeps it till i re-power. More, only half lights.
What did i miss ?
-
I'd try using one of the extra servo out ports like 5 or 6. If it's a full size revo the connector pins should be easier to connect to than the flexi-io port. And if it's a "cc3d-mini-revo" the flexi-io port doesn't have pins 3 and 4 on it so the servo outs are the only choice.
I put the stock cc3d that doesn't support LEDs back on my Racer 250 so I can't run any tests.
edit: another thought, did you put tape or something under the unsoldered tab to make sure it's not touching the main board?
